OpenAI API Clients

Python CLI and GUI clients to interact with OpenAI's API.

Installation

Note: Prefer your distribution packages if possible.

For the CLI client:

pip install openai rich

For the GUI client (Tkinter is often part of the standard Python installation):

pip install openai tkinterweb mistletoe pygments

Usage

API Key

Expects an OPENAI_API_KEY environment variable, or a .api_key file in the repo directory or data directory (~/.chatgpt-gui/) as a fallback. The filename is in .gitignore already.

Conversations are automatically saved as JSON files in ~/.chatgpt-gui/. Override the location with the CHATGPT_GUI_DATA_DIR environment variable:

export CHATGPT_GUI_DATA_DIR=/path/to/your/data

CLI Client

./cli.py

Quit with q, x, exit, quit, Ctrl+C, or Ctrl+D.

Options

Flag Description
-m, --multiline Multiline input mode — type your message, then enter SEND to submit
-b, --batch-mode Non-interactive mode for pipes and redirection
-M, --model Select a specific model
-w, --web-search Enable web search with source extraction
-ig, --image-generation Enable image generation; images saved to the data directory
--image-size Generated image size (auto or WIDTHxHEIGHT, e.g. 1024x1024); default 1024x1024
--image-quality Generated image quality: auto, low, medium, high; default low
--image-format Generated image format: png, jpeg, webp; default jpeg
--image-model Image generation model: gpt-image-2, gpt-image-1.5, gpt-image-1, gpt-image-1-mini; default gpt-image-1-mini
-p, --prepend Prepend a string (followed by two newlines) to the first message
-pf, --prepend-file Prepend a file's contents to the first message
-i, --image Image file(s) to include
-f, --file Document(s) to include
-vf, --vectorize-file Document(s) to upload to a vector store for semantic file search
-vs, --vector-store Use a pre-existing vector store by ID for semantic file search; can be combined with -vf to upload additional files into it (files are kept after the session)
-r, --rich Render Markdown with rich text formatting in the terminal
-d, --debug Pretty-print raw API responses to stderr
-l, --list-known List models with known pricing
-L, --list-all List all available models

File Management

./cli.py files list                   # list uploaded files
./cli.py files add report.pdf         # upload a file, prints the file ID
./cli.py files delete FILE_ID ...     # delete one or more files by ID
./cli.py files purge                  # delete all uploaded files

Vector Store Management

./cli.py vectors list                                           # list vector stores
./cli.py vectors create NAME                                    # create an empty vector store, prints the vector store ID
./cli.py vectors create NAME doc1.pdf doc2.pdf                  # create a vector store, upload and index files, prints the ID
./cli.py vectors create NAME doc.pdf --no-wait                  # same but return immediately without waiting for indexing
./cli.py vectors delete VECTOR_STORE_ID                         # delete a vector store
./cli.py vectors purge                                          # delete all vector stores
./cli.py vectors files list VECTOR_STORE_ID                     # list files in a vector store
./cli.py vectors files add VECTOR_STORE_ID file1.pdf ...        # upload and add file(s) to a vector store
./cli.py vectors files add-id VECTOR_STORE_ID FILE_ID ...       # add already-uploaded file(s) to a vector store by ID
./cli.py vectors files delete VECTOR_STORE_ID FILE_ID ...       # remove one or more files from a vector store

Batch Mode Examples

./cli.py -b <<< "Tell a joke" > joke.txt
./cli.py -b < prompt.txt > output.txt
./cli.py -b --prepend-file summarize_prompt.txt < article.txt
./cli.py -b -p "Summarize the following text:" < article.txt
./cli.py -b -f report.pdf <<< "Summarize this document"
./cli.py -b -f cv.pdf job.pdf <<< "Is this candidate a good fit?"
./cli.py -b -vf contracts/*.pdf <<< "Which contracts mention arbitration?"
./cli.py -vf docs/*.pdf  # interactive Q&A session across a document collection
./cli.py -vs vs_abc123   # interactive Q&A using a pre-existing vector store
./cli.py -vs vs_abc123 -vf extra.pdf  # same, but also upload extra.pdf into it (file kept after session)

The tool is quite powerful with guake drop-down terminal and alias like this:

alias gpt='$HOME/projects/chatgpt-gui/cli.py'

More useful example to review patch of PR for currently checked out branch in the current directory (expects gh client installed):

alias review='gh pr diff --patch | gpt -b -pf $HOME/.pr-review'

The .pr-review file contains:

Summarize and review the following patch:

GUI Client

./gui.py

Browse past conversations and chat interactively with full Markdown rendering and syntax highlighting.

  • Resizable panes — drag the separators between panels to adjust layout
  • Sortable conversation list — click the column header to toggle sort order
  • Keyboard shortcutsEnter to send, Shift+Enter for a new line

Other Tools

  • whisper.py — transcribe audio using OpenAI's Whisper API
  • dale.py — generate images using DALL-E 3 (./dale.py "prompt" [-n N] [-j N])

Development

Install test dependencies:

pip install pytest pytest-xdist

Format, lint, and test with:

make format
make lint
make test   # sequential
make xtest  # parallel (16 workers)

Run a single test suite:

python -m pytest tests/e2e_test.py::TestBatchMode -v

Run a single test case:

python -m pytest tests/e2e_test.py::TestBatchMode::test_batch_basic -v
